What Is AI Media Buying?
AI media buying is the use of machine learning systems to plan, purchase, and continuously optimize digital advertising placements across channels like paid social, search, and programmatic, replacing much of the manual work of targeting, bidding, budgeting, and creative rotation with data-driven automation.
- Ingesting historical and live performance data across ad platforms
- Automating bid and budget decisions in real time
- Testing and rotating creative variants based on observed outcomes
- Applying guardrails for brand safety, suitability, and compliance
- Reporting outcomes and recommendations in an auditable, human-readable form
How Does an AI Media Buyer Differ From Traditional Automation?
Traditional performance marketing automation focuses on rule-based optimization inside ad platforms: automated bidding, basic budget pacing, and pre-set audience rules that still require human configuration and frequent intervention. AI media buyers add model-driven decision-making, learning from large volumes of data to adjust budgets, bids, and creative combinations continuously without a human queuing each step.
In practice, that means moving from "if CPC > X, then lower bid" style rules to systems that consider many concurrent signals—creative, audience, placement, time, and conversion paths—to reallocate spend toward higher-quality impressions. Agentic tools described in recent analyses can even act like digital team members, running the execution loop of production, launch, optimization, and reporting under guardrails you define.
From a business perspective, this shift changes how you manage CAC and pipeline. Instead of manually chasing efficiency in individual accounts, you supervise a system that continuously reduces waste, surfaces anomalies faster, and pushes more budget into net-new opportunities that are likely to convert. The exact impact is company-specific, but the value comes from fewer manual decisions and tighter feedback loops.
What Are the Core Components of an AI Media Buyer?
An effective AI media buyer combines several technical and operational layers rather than being a single "magic" model. At a minimum, you are orchestrating data ingestion, modeling, decisioning, execution, and reporting across one or more ad platforms.
Modeling typically turns raw performance data into predictions: which impressions, audiences, or creative variants are likely to produce the outcomes you care about, such as qualified leads or purchases. Decision engines then translate those predictions into concrete changes—adjusting budgets, pausing underperforming campaigns, or launching new variants—while enforcement layers respect your brand, compliance, and spend guardrails.
Done well, this stack supports more consistent CAC and healthier pipeline quality. Because decisions are made continuously rather than during weekly reviews, ad dollars are reallocated away from low-value placements more quickly, and more of your spend supports segments with stronger downstream conversion and revenue velocity.

How Does an AI Media Buyer Actually Work Day to Day?
Operationally, an AI media buyer runs a loop: ingest data, predict outcomes, act, and learn. On any given day, it pulls fresh performance and conversion data from ad platforms, updates models, and then adjusts bids, budgets, and creative mix based on current signals rather than static plans. Agent-style systems go further by generating and launching variants within guardrails.
In detailed breakdowns, autonomous media buying agents are described as handling tasks like variant production, campaign structuring, intraday budget shuffling, and kill-and-scale decisions across channels such as Meta and TikTok. Crucially, they operate continuously—including off-hours—so low-performing spend is trimmed and high-performing pockets are scaled without waiting for a human to log in.
The business effect is tighter control over effective CAC and more consistent pipeline flow. Instead of big swings driven by batch optimizations, spend is nudged steadily toward better-performing segments. You still measure outcomes against your baseline, but more of your budget should reach prospects with higher conversion potential, improving revenue velocity over time.
What Decisions Can You Safely Delegate to an AI Media Buyer?
Current consensus is that AI is best suited to the execution layer of media buying, not the judgment layer. Execution covers tasks like building campaigns, turning briefs into variants, launching ads, monitoring intraday performance, and making incremental budget changes based on predefined objectives. Judgment remains human: brand positioning, offer design, channel mix, and compliance interpretation.
Industry guidance frames this division clearly: an autonomous media buying agent can run hundreds of creative variants per month, read performance, and reallocate budget under constraints you set, but it should not decide your overarching brand strategy or regulatory stance. Safely delegating means defining objectives and guardrails precisely, then giving the system room to operate within them.
From a CAC and pipeline standpoint, this division protects you from "over-automation." AI handles the high-volume, low-judgment decisions where speed matters most, while humans steer the high-leverage calls whose impact on revenue and risk profile can be outsized. That balance supports both efficiency and resilience in your go-to-market motions.

How Do Agentic AI Media Buyers Compare to Rules-Based Tools?
Recent reviews of performance marketing automation tools describe a tiered landscape: platform-native automation, rules-based cross-channel tools, and agentic AI media buyers. Rules-based tools let you codify conditions and actions across accounts—if-then logic for budgets, bids, and alerts. Agentic systems interpret goals and constraints and then make decisions more flexibly.
Rules-based tools like classic PPC and paid social managers excel at transparency and control: you specify the conditions explicitly and can audit every action against those rules. Agentic systems trade some of that granular rule-writing for higher-level objectives, using models to decide when and how to act within guardrails, often through conversational interfaces rather than dense dashboards.
In business terms, rules-based automation works well when your team can invest in ongoing configuration and monitoring. Agentic AI becomes attractive when headcount is limited relative to account complexity and spend. The right choice depends on your tolerance for abstraction, need for speed, and how you balance CAC discipline with the scalability of your media operations.

What Are the Risks and Guardrails of AI Media Buying?
Any autonomous system touching paid spend carries risk: misaligned objectives, poor data quality, and weak guardrails can produce wasted budget or brand missteps. Commentators emphasize the need for clearly defined constraints around brand safety, suitability, compliance, and maximum budget exposure. AI media buyers should be configured to respect these before taking action.
Agentic AI differs from simple rules in that it interprets goals, which makes supervision and logging essential. Responsible setups include audit logs, approval flows for sensitive changes, and kill switches that let human operators override or pause automation when needed. Testing on limited budgets and non-critical campaigns is recommended before scaling.
From a CAC and revenue standpoint, guardrails prevent efficiency from becoming risk. You want the system to aggressively optimize spend, but only within the boundaries that protect your brand and financial exposure. Done well, those controls help ensure that any gains in pipeline and velocity are sustainable—not the result of cutting corners on quality or compliance.
How Do You Roll Out an AI Media Buyer Without Disrupting Existing Operations?
Successful rollouts generally follow a staged approach: pilot, expand, then normalize. Expert guidance suggests starting with a subset of accounts or campaigns where you can tolerate experimentation, defining clear success metrics (like cost per qualified lead or incremental pipeline value) and comparing AI-led execution to your current process. This keeps risk manageable while generating real evidence.
During pilots, keep humans firmly in the loop. Operators should review the AI's decisions, understand why changes were made, and adjust guardrails accordingly. Over time, as trust grows and performance stabilizes, you can let the system handle more of the execution layer while your team shifts attention to strategy, experimentation, and cross-channel design.
The business benefit of this measured rollout is a smoother transition in CAC and pipeline dynamics. Instead of flipping a switch and hoping, you gradually reassign tasks from people to systems, monitoring whether the AI maintains or improves your efficiency. This approach protects revenue velocity while building an autonomous marketing execution capability.

What is an AI media buyer in performance marketing?
An AI media buyer in performance marketing is a system that uses machine learning to plan, purchase, and optimize digital ad placements across channels based on real-time data rather than static rules. It ingests performance and conversion signals, predicts where spend is most effective, and continuously adjusts bids, budgets, and creative mix under guardrails you set. Unlike simple automation, it can act autonomously on those insights. The impact should be measured against your own baseline in terms of reduced wasted spend, more qualified pipeline, and more stable acquisition costs.
How does AI media buying reduce wasted ad spend?
AI media buying reduces wasted ad spend by continuously reallocating budgets away from low-performing audiences, placements, and creative variants and toward segments that generate better downstream outcomes. It analyzes performance beyond top-line metrics like clicks, using conversion and pipeline data where available to judge quality, not just volume. By operating on intraday feedback loops, it trims ineffective spend sooner than manual reviews would. Teams should track how much budget is shifted from non-converting segments over time and whether that corresponds to healthier CAC and more qualified opportunities.
